To provide clothing, toys, sporting equipment, and more to foster and adoptive families.
Jose's Closet is a resource center for foster, adoptive, and kinship families. We provide clothing, shoes, toys, books, games, baby gear & equipment, sports equipment and more to children in need. We have the following distribution programs; Clothing Distribution, Equipment Distribution, Sports Equipment Distribution, Bicycle Distribution, Dance Equipment Distribution, School Supply Distribution, Toy & Game Distribution, Holiday Gift Distribution, Easter Basket & Halloween Costume Distribution. We have a Diaper Bank, Infant formula Bank and Food Bank. Jose's Closet is a Arizona Qualifying Foster Care Charitable Organization.
